A new thread-level speculative automatic parallelization model and library based on duplicate code execution

Millán A. Martinez,
Basilio B. Fraguela,
José C. Cabaleiro
et al.

Abstract: Loop-efficient automatic parallelization has become increasingly relevant due to the growing number of cores in current processors and the programming effort needed to parallelize codes in these systems efficiently. However, automatic tools fail to extract all the available parallelism in irregular loops with indirections, race conditions or potential data dependency violations, among many other possible causes.
